TALK TITLE: Human-Machine Collaboration and Communication
The Meet a Data Scientist series is a chance to get up close and personal with top-level data science professionals. Join us for a talk with Prof. Ching-Hua Chuan whose research interests include artificial intelligence, machine learning, and music information retrieval with a focus on human-centered computing.
The purpose of the Meet a Data Scientist lecture series is to introduce our audience to the people behind the data, their lives, interests, career choices, their work, and passion for how they can use data to solve grand challenges in their respective fields. Join us as we peer behind the curtain and meet the data scientists behind the data!
One of the key controversies regarding AI centers on how AI systems and automation will replace humans. In this talk, Dr. Chuan will share her various interdisciplinary projects that highlight the collaboration between human and machine. As a computer scientist by training, Dr. Chuan’s work focuses on creating new algorithms and new ways to represent information and knowledge in different media and interactions, with the goal to create computing systems that are able to (1) understand the semantic meanings in complex data and make accurate interpretations, and (2) interact and collaborate with humans to achieve something no humans or machines can perform alone.
